Category: Television Series Doctor Who is a television series that has been running for over 50 years. It follows the adventures of the Doctor, a time-traveling alien who uses his regenerative abilities to protect Earth and its inhabitants from various threats. The show has gone through many changes throughout the years, with different actors playing the role of the Doctor and new companions joining the cast each season.
